Output 09d63de047f50d5ec63607a52394b5f4448e1507fd3da866208180dc7abddbba:48

value
29445151
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 048801edec1b6d7215946e8927b715eb5d2315a1b8ff6ea1c766114198323cec
address
tb1pqjyqrm0vrdkhy9v5d6yj0dc4adwjx9dphrlkagw8vcg5rxpj8nkq0yev4n
transaction
09d63de047f50d5ec63607a52394b5f4448e1507fd3da866208180dc7abddbba
confirmations
20841
spent
true